Rack & Pinion

All,

I have asked similar question in past but now I am down to actually purchasing and installing so I will ask with more detail this time.

I am building a CNC router that has a 4' x 4' operational area. It is a gantry type so there will be dual racks on one of the axis. Here are the questions:

1. What ration / pressure angle is best for the application?? Plan to do a gear redution drive on the steppers for increased resolution.

2. Where is the best place (most cost effective) to purchase the racks and pinions.

3. Any other ideas for driving this size of machine. It will also be a plasma so it will need to have jog rates at 1000ipm and drive a plasma at 800ipm.

By far the best pricing I found on rack was here http://www.stdsteel.com/gr_stock.htm and I had zero problems with the purchase. But you have to ask for pricing and shipping and send a check, no credit cards. I have heard they have gone to per piece cost on shipping based on two shipping zones lately. I bought a gear blank from McMaster that's 12" long that I intend to make my own pinions from. Lot's cheaper and I can get the 1/2" bore that I need that way (I sure love my 12x36 lathe!.) I went with the 20DP and 20 tooth pinion but have yet to build. I've gotta finish the mill first.

You need to check out the MechMate at http://www.mechmate.com/ and also be sure to scan the forums. They've already got a motor/rack/pinion combo worked out. Plenty of info and it's free.

Originally Posted by captainkirk View Post
Any other ideas for driving this size of machine. It will also be a plasma so it will need to have jog rates at 1000ipm and drive a plasma at 800ipm.
The links to the rack and 7.2:1 geared motors will do about 1,400 IPM *IF* you use something like the Gecko G100 or SmoothStepper, it's not possible with those motors/gearing to get above about 600-800 IPM with a standard parrallel port and a current PC without loosing steps.
